Travel Tips
Although notebooks are designed to be as robust as possible to cater
for a mobile lifestyle, extreme care and caution should be taken when
travelling. When travelling by land, sea or air, every precaution should
be taken to make sure that the notebook is well secured when it is not in
use.
● Themostessentialaccessoryyoushouldhavewhentravellingisa
good carry case for your notebook. The case should be well
padded to protect your notebook from drops and bumps, etc and
should be big enough to hold the size of notebook.
● MakesurethereisenoughroomtocarryyourACAdapterand
spare battery etc. Only carry the necessary items in your carry
case, as the weight can become tedious especially when walking
long distances or waiting in long queue’s.
● Whentravellingbyair,neverbookyournotebookwithchecked
baggage. Always declare it as hand baggage so that you can carry
it into the airplane cabin with you. Most airlines allow two pieces of
hand baggage with one of them being a bag or carry case with a
portable notebook. Please consult your local airline for more details.
● WhenplacingyournotebookonanX-Ray,makesurethatyoukeep
a close eye on it when it is on the conveyor belt. Hold on to your
notebook until the last minute before placing it on the conveyor.
In some airports it could be stolen while you are stuck in a queue
waiting to pass through the metal detector.
● NotebooksandharddrivescanpassthroughX-Raymachinesbut
never allow these to pass through a metal detector. This can cause
data loss to the hard drive.
● Neverplaceyournotebookintheoverheadstoragecompartmentas
this can make it susceptible to damage caused by turbulence that
maybeexperiencedduringtheightorinothercasetheft.Youcan
store your notebook under your seat, where it is always in sight.
● Youshouldtakeeveryprecautiontoprotectyournotebookfromdust,
dirt, liquid spillage, food droppings, extreme weather conditions and
direct exposure to sunlight.
● Whentravellingbetweendifferentclimates,fromoneextremeto
another, condensation may occur inside the notebook. If this does
happen,pleaseallowsufcienttimeforthemoisturetoevaporate
completely, before attempting to switch on.
● Whentravellingfromextremelycoldertoextremelywarmerclimates
in a short space of time, and vice versa, please allow the notebook
some time to adapt to the change in environment.
